A growing and well-established engineering service business is seeking a Mechanical Fitter to join its Doncaster team. This is an excellent opportunity for a mechanically minded candidate looking to build a long-term career with full training, recognised qualifications, and strong earning potential. Previous experience with hydraulics or hydraulic hoses would be advantageous, although candidates with general mechanical aptitude and a strong work ethic are encouraged to apply.
The Role
Following an initial fully paid two-week training programme, the successful candidate will gain a City & Guilds qualification and receive the tools and support needed to succeed in the role. Once trained, the candidate will operate a company van, attending customer sites across the region to repair and maintain machinery, delivering high levels of service and technical support.
Key Responsibilities
- Attend customer call-outs to diagnose and repair machinery
- Install, service, and replace hydraulic hoses and related components
- Promote company products and services to existing and prospective customers
- Maintain stock levels within the company service vehicle
- Carry out routine vehicle checks and ensure the van is clean
